Company Expenses Total Assets Net Income Total Liabilities Dreamworks $ 22,000 $ 40,000 $ 19,000 $ 30,000 Pixar 67,000 150,000 2
Luda [366]

Answer:

                      Expenses   Total Assets   Net Income   Total Liabilities

Dreamworks   $22,000      $40,000         $19,000         $30,000

Pixar                $67,000      $150,000        $27,000        $147,000

Universal         $12,000      $68,000          $5,000          $17,000

<u>Debt ratio:</u> Total Debt / Total Assets

Dreamworks = $30,000 / $40,000 = 0.75

Pixar = $147,000 / $150,000 = 0.98

Universal = $17,000 / $68,000 = 0.25

<u>Financial Leverage:</u> Asset / Equity

Dreamworks = $40,000 / (40,000-30,0000) = 4

Pixar = $150,000 / (150,000-147,000) = 50

Universal = $68,000 / (68,000-17000) = 1.33

Pixar Has the most financial leverage.
